Nov. 5 (Bloomberg) -- Australia has set up a commissionof inquiry into an oil spill in the Timor Sea off northwesternAustralia that spewed as much as 400 barrels a day for more than 10 weeks.

David Borthwick, a former Secretary of the Department ofthe Environment, Water, Heritage and the Arts, will run theinvestigation, Energy Minister Martin Ferguson said inCanberra today. Borthwick, who will have the power to summonwitnesses and evidence, must report by the end of April.
